One thing I eventually did discover, is that I tended to drive a bit more towards the left-hand side of my lane...the vehicle tries to center you, and if you're passing someone on a multi-lane road, it was a little spooky until I realized, it was doing a better job of centering me in my lane than I was...Once that realization took hold, I was not fighting the steering at all anymore. So far, and it's only happened once, it steered me off-center and noted that the vehicle to my right was crowding me around a curve. In that case, I think it actually had my left-hand wheels either on or over the lane marker, where normally, it would have been shaking the steering wheel to tell me I was there...this was all done by the vehicle by itself without my intervention.
The system has a learning curve, and, as I found, was actually doing what it should have. |

The March update wasn't sent to me until way after the next one was available at the dealerships during a maintenance update for a specific problem before mine updated...and, it skipped last November's update entirely. I was told that, depending on the specific configuration, there may not be something in one of the periodic updates for every vehicle, and the vehicle may not receive it. Plus, it's not like a WIN or iOS update, where most of the world gets it at nearly the same time...it gets pushed to vehicles, and it's not obvious what priority scheme is used, but BMW has said, it is phased by market, and Germany would get it first. There's no way to 'pull' it manually. You either get it OTA, or have the software applied by a dealer or someone that has the files.
